   Pre-heating mitigates composite degradation

چکیده    Dental composites cured at high temperatures show improved properties and higher degrees of conversion; however,there is no information available about the effect of pre-heating on material degradation. objectives: this study evaluated the effect of pre­heating on the degradation of composites,based on the analysis of radiopacity and silver penetration using scanning electron microscopy/energy-dispersive x-ray spectroscopy (sem/eds). material and methods: thirty specimens were fabricated using a metallic matri× (2×8 mm) and the composites durafill vs (heraeus kulzer),z-250 (3m/espe),and z-350 (3m/espe),cured at 25°c (no pre-heating) or 60°c (pre-heating). specimens were stored sequentially in the following solutions: 1) water for 7 days (60°c),plus 0.1 n sodium hydroxide (naoh) for 14 days (60°c); 2) 50% silver nitrate (agno3) for 10 days (60°c). specimens were radiographed at baseline and after each storage time,and the images were evaluated in gray scale. after the storage protocol,samples were analyzed using sem/eds to check the depth of silver penetration. radiopacity and silver penetration data were analyzed using anova and tukey’s tests (α=5%). results: radiopacity levels were as follows: durafill vs<z-350<z-250 (p<0.05). the depth of silver penetration into the composites ranked as follows: durafill vs>z-350>z-250 (p<0.05). after storage in water/ naoh,pre-heated specimens presented higher radiopacity values than non-pre-heated specimens (p<0.05). there was a lower penetration of silver in pre-heated specimens (p<0.05). conclusions: pre-heating at 60°c mitigated the degradation of composites based on analysis of radiopacity and silver penetration depth. © 2015,faculdade de odontologia de bauru. all rights reserved.
